The best color diamond is generally considered to be the colorless or white diamond. These diamonds are graded on a scale from D (colorless) to Z (light yellow or brown). In the diamond industry, colorless diamonds with a higher grade (closer to D) are highly valued due to their rarity and desirability. Colorless diamonds allow more light to pass through, creating a dazzling sparkle and enhancing the overall brilliance of the stone. They are often more expensive compared to diamonds with visible color. However, it's important to note that diamond color preference is subjective and some individuals may prefer fancy colored diamonds like vivid yellows, pinks, or blues, which are also highly sought after and can be quite valuable.

The Hermès Birkin bag is considered to be the most coveted and desired Hermès bag. It is an iconic luxury handbag that has gained global recognition and has a reputation for being incredibly difficult to obtain. The Birkin bag was first created in 1984 and named after the actress and singer Jane Birkin. It is known for its exquisite craftsmanship, timeless design, and scarcity. The Hermès Birkin bag has a memorable silhouette with its structured shape, double rolled handles, and signature clochette and padlock. It is crafted from various high-quality materials such as leather, including the popular Togo, Epsom, and Clemence, as well as exotic skins like alligator and crocodile. Each Birkin bag is meticulously handmade by skilled artisans, taking several hours to complete. The bags often feature intricate details and hardware, making them truly exceptional pieces. The exclusivity and rarity of the Birkin bag contribute to its immense popularity. They are not openly available for purchase in stores and can only be acquired through a lengthy waiting list or by developing a strong relationship with Hermès. As a result, the demand for the Hermès Birkin bag far outweighs the supply, making it highly coveted by fashion enthusiasts, collectors, and celebrities.

Richard Woods is known for being a prominent British artist and designer. He is renowned for his distinctive and vibrant woodblock printing technique, which he applies to various surfaces including walls, floors, and furniture. Woods' work often features bold and playful patterns that explore the themes of domesticity, architectural landscapes, and consumer culture. His unique style incorporates a mix of traditional craftsmanship and contemporary aesthetics, creating a visual language that blurs the boundaries between art, design, and architecture. Richard Woods' artistic contributions have not only gained recognition within the art world but have also significantly influenced the field of contemporary design and production.
